A diaphragm coupling is a flexible coupling used in turbo machinery to transfer torque between two shafts that may experience slight misalignment. This coupling design consists of two sets of thin metallic diaphragms that are bolted together to form a series of corrugations.

There are different types of diaphragm couplings utilized in turbo machinery, mainly categorized as single diaphragm and double/multiple diaphragm couplings. A single diaphragm coupling is a flexible coupling specifically designed to transmit torque between two rotating shafts that may be slightly misaligned. These couplings find applications in various energy equipment such as drilling equipment, turbine drives, compressors, and other turbo machinery. They are constructed using materials such as metal diaphragms, plastic diaphragms, and others, making them suitable for diverse applications across industries such as power, oil and gas, chemicals, transportation, and more.

Tariffs are impacting the diaphragm coupling in turbo machinery market by increasing costs of imported high-grade alloys, precision-machined diaphragms, fastening systems, and specialized manufacturing equipment. Energy, oil and gas, and chemical industries in North America and Europe are particularly affected due to dependence on imported high-performance couplings. These tariffs are increasing capital equipment costs and extending procurement cycles. However, they are also driving localized manufacturing, supplier diversification, and innovation in alternative high-strength coupling materials.

The diaphragm coupling in turbo machinery market size has grown strongly in recent years. It will grow from $4.97 billion in 2025 to $5.24 billion in 2026 at a compound annual growth rate (CAGR) of 5.5%. The growth in the historic period can be attributed to expansion of power generation infrastructure, growth in oil and gas processing facilities, increasing use of turbo compressors, availability of high-strength diaphragm materials, rising focus on equipment reliability.

The diaphragm coupling in turbo machinery market size is expected to see strong growth in the next few years. It will grow to $6.68 billion in 2030 at a compound annual growth rate (CAGR) of 6.3%. The growth in the forecast period can be attributed to increasing investments in energy infrastructure modernization, rising adoption of high-efficiency turbo machinery, expansion of chemical processing capacity, growing demand for low-maintenance couplings, increasing focus on predictive maintenance. Major trends in the forecast period include increasing use in high-speed turbo machinery, rising demand for high-torque transmission solutions, growing adoption in power generation systems, expansion of custom engineered couplings, enhanced focus on vibration control.

The increasing focus on renewable energy integration is expected to contribute to the growth of diaphragm couplings in the turbo machinery market. Renewable energy integration involves the incorporation of sources such as wind, solar, geothermal, and hydroelectric power into the existing electric grid. Diaphragm couplings emerge as a favorable choice for renewable energy applications, including solar and wind power, owing to their features such as low backlash, low vibration transmission, high torque capacity, and sustainability benefits. According to the Energy Information Administration, it is anticipated that 16% of total energy generation in 2023 will come from renewable sources such as wind and solar, up from 14% in 2022. The increasing focus on renewable energy integration is thus driving the growth of diaphragm couplings in the turbo machinery market.

Product innovation is a significant trend gaining traction in the diaphragm coupling segment of the turbomachinery market. Leading companies in this sector are creating innovative products to maintain their competitive edge. For example, in April 2024, SKF, a Sweden-based company, launched a series of diaphragm couplings designed to offer cost-effective, lubrication-free operation for high-torque applications with medium torsional stiffness. These couplings are available in various configurations, including single and double disc designs, and can be installed in both horizontal and vertical orientations, supporting load capacities of up to 178 kNm. Made with all-steel mechanical components, SKF diaphragm couplings ensure reliable performance and are particularly suited for high-speed applications due to their two-plane dynamic balance.

In April 2023, Regal Rexnord Corporation, a US-based manufacturer specializing in power transmission components and electric motors, acquired Altra Industrial Motion Corp. for an undisclosed amount. This acquisition is positioned to broaden, diversify, and enhance Regal Rexnord Corporation's product portfolio. The collaboration between the two companies aims to improve the existing automation product portfolio and provide high-value offerings to customers. Altra Industrial Motion Corp., the acquired entity, is a US-based manufacturer specializing in diaphragm couplings, brakes, clutches, and other power transmission products.
